Definition

Shift work is any work schedule outside the standard daytime hours. It disrupts circadian biology in ways that produce real, measurable health effects, and it is one of the most under-treated occupational health issues.

Why it matters

Shift workers are asked to override their biology for their livelihood. Acknowledging the cost — and mitigating it — is a matter of both health and justice.

The Science

Shift work is classified as a probable human carcinogen by IARC and is associated with metabolic syndrome, cardiovascular disease, cognitive impairment, and mood disorders. Directional rotation, light exposure, and strategic napping can reduce, but not eliminate, harm.

Clinical Implications

Shift-work sleep disorder is a diagnosable, treatable condition. Occupational health approaches should include circadian science.
